Tuning circuits are electrical circuits designed to select specific frequencies from a broader range of signals, typically using components like resistors, inductors, and capacitors. These circuits are essential in applications like radios and televisions, where they filter out unwanted frequencies and enhance signal clarity. By adjusting the circuit elements, tuning circuits can resonate at a desired frequency, allowing for the reception of specific signals while rejecting others.
